| Summary | Electronic Arts (EA) is a publicly traded video game developer and publisher known for major franchises including EA SPORTS FC, Battlefield, Apex Legends, The Sims, and Madden NFL, delivering games and live services across console, PC, and mobile platforms. EA applies AI and ML in game development for procedural generation, NPC behavior, and anti-cheat systems, though it is not an AI-first organization. | Amazon AI is the AI product and services division of AWS, offering a broad stack of managed AI services (Bedrock, SageMaker, Amazon Q, Lex, Rekognition, Comprehend, Transcribe, Kendra, and more), custom silicon (Trainium, Inferentia), and first-party foundation models (Nova, Chronos) for developers and enterprises building AI-powered applications on AWS infrastructure. |
